2. Technical Edge: Why Smartphones Deliver Smoother Gameplay

Modern smartphones now house octa‑core processors and dedicated GPUs that rival low‑end laptops. The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 and Apple’s A17 Bionic chips enable real‑time rendering of 3D slot reels at 90 Hz, eliminating the lag that once plagued mobile casino apps.

Operating‑system optimization also matters. iOS 18’s low‑power mode prioritizes network packets for gaming, while Android 14’s scoped storage reduces app launch times to under two seconds for most casino titles. These OS improvements translate directly into faster free‑spin triggers; a spin that once required a 1.2‑second buffer now fires in under 0.6 seconds.

Adaptive bitrate streaming further smooths the experience. When a player’s connection dips from 4G to 3G, the casino client automatically lowers video quality while preserving spin animation fidelity, preventing dropped frames that could disrupt bonus activation.

Instant‑load technologies such as progressive web apps (PWAs) allow users to start a free‑spin round without a full download, cutting friction to a few taps. The net result is a seamless, latency‑free environment where bonus mechanics feel native rather than bolted on.

3. User‑Experience Design Tailored for Touch

Touch interaction reshapes every UI element. Gesture‑based navigation—swipe left to change reels, pinch to zoom the paytable—replaces mouse clicks, creating a more intuitive flow for free‑spin sessions.

Designers now employ responsive scaling that adapts button size to screen real estate. On a 5.5‑inch phone, the “Spin” button expands to 48 px for comfortable thumb reach, while on a 6.8‑inch phablet it contracts slightly to preserve visual balance.

Accessibility has become a priority. Haptic feedback delivers a subtle vibration each time a free spin lands on a winning line, reinforcing the reward loop without requiring visual focus. Dark mode, now a default option on many casino apps, conserves battery life and reduces eye strain during late‑night New Year celebrations.

6. Security and Trust on Mobile Devices

Security standards have kept pace with the mobile surge. TLS 1.3 encryption now encrypts 99.9 % of data packets between the player’s device and the casino server, reducing the risk of man‑in‑the‑middle attacks during free‑spin redemption.

Biometric authentication adds another layer. Face ID on iOS and fingerprint sensors on Android devices allow players to verify withdrawals with a single glance, eliminating the need for cumbersome passwords.

Regulatory compliance remains non‑negotiable. Operators must adhere to GDPR for EU users, ensuring that personal data collected through mobile apps is stored securely and processed transparently. eCOGRA certification, frequently displayed within the app’s “Security” tab, reassures players that the free‑spin mechanics are fair and audited.
